Ceramic tile repl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ated tiles and installing new ones to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ces. This process typically includes carefully taking out broken or worn tiles, preparing the underlying surface, and applying new tiles with appropriate adhesive and grout. The goal is to achieve a seamless, durable finish that enhances the aesthetic appeal of are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and commercial spaces. Skilled contractors ensure that the replacement tiles are properly aligned and securely set, resulting in a long-lasting solution for tiled surfaces.
This service addresses common problems such as cracked, chipped, or stained tiles that can compromise both the look and safety of a space. Over time, tiles may become loose or damaged due to heavy foot traffic, impacts, or moisture exposure, leading to potential tripping hazards or water infiltration. Ceramic tile replacement helps eliminate these issues by replacing compromised tiles, preventing further deterioration, and maintaining the integrity of the surface. Material and Size Costs - The cost of ceramic tile replacement typically ranges from $5 to $15 per square foot for materials, depending on the quality and design. Larger or custom tiles may incre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ing ceramic tiles generally fall between $4 and $12 per square foot. Factors influencing price include the complexity of removal and prep work required.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to the project scope.
Removal and Disposal - Removing existing tiles and disposing of debris may add $1 to $3 per square foot to the total cost. The extent of old material to be removed can impact the overall price. Local contractors can assess the site for accurate pricing.
Additional Costs - Expenses such as surface preparation or subfloor repair can range from $2 to $8 per square foot. These extra services ensure a durable finish but may vary based on the condition of the existing surface. Local pros can evaluate and estimate these potential cost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in ceramic tile replacement? Ceramic tile replacement typically includes removing damaged or outdated tiles, preparing the surface, and installing new tiles to match the existing design.
How long does ceramic tile replacement usually take? The duration varies depending on the area size and complexity of the work, but most projects are completed within a few hours to a couple of days.
Can damaged tiles be replaced without affecting the surrounding tiles? Yes, experienced service providers can replace individual tiles while minimizing impact on adjacent tiles and the surrounding surface.
Is it necessary to remove all tiles during replacement? Not necessarily; only damaged or outdated tiles need to be removed, allowing for targeted replacement and preservation of existing work.
